Prince William, Kate thinking about ‘risks’ as Prince Harry comes back home
Prince William and Prince Harry do not want to be taken back by Prince Harry‘s return to the UK
Prince William and Kate Milton are not happy with Prince Harry’s return to the UK.
The Prince and Princess of Wales, who are active members of the senior Royal community, are blindsided by what Harry’s move next move could be.
Royal commentator Duncan Larcombe cited a source in Woman & Home as saying: "William is extremely concerned about what Harry's return to Britain will mean for working members of the family. It may well be too risky for them to just sit back and let Harry make the next move."
In between all the uncertainty, Prince William has no choice but to sit across Prince Harry and speak about future plans.
The insider says this will help "lay down, or at least reiterate, some of the rules.”
Prince Harry left the Royal Family back in 2020 alongside wife Meghan Markle and son, Prince Archie. The couple later accused the Royal Family of showcasing racism towards their son and publicly shared their grievances on television. Harry and Meghan now live in California, where they also welcomed their daughter, Princess Lilibet.
